#9e5b31 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9e5b31 is composed of 62% red, 35.7%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.4% magenta, 69%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 23.1 degrees, a saturation of 52.7% and a lightness of 40.6%. #9e5b31 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b662 with #3d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#9e5b31 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9e5b31 has RGB values of R:158, G:91,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.42, Y:0.69,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10378033.

Shades and Tints of #9e5b31

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080503 is the darkest color, while #fdfaf8 is the lightest one.
